Youth beaten to death in Odisha, family demands justice

A youth was allegedly beaten to death at Buguda village under Daspalla police limits in Nayagarh district on Thursday evening.
The deceased has been identified as Saroj Bisi.
According to sources, Saroj had a heated argument with some youths of nearby Banka Taila village during Holi celebrations. Later, he returned home.
It was when Saroj was sleeping alone in his home that some youths from Banka Taila village entered his house and started beating him.
They continued to beat him till they were sure that he was dead. After committing the crime, they left the place.
On being informed, a team from Daspalla Police Station along with a scientific team reached the spot. The police recovered the body and sent it for post-mortem and have launched a detailed probe into the case.
While the crime sent shivers down the village, the family members of the deceased demanded justice.

7th Pay Commission: Modi govt hikes Dearness Allowance by 4%, check details

In a bonanza for 48 lakh Central government employees and 70 lakh pensioners, the government on Friday hiked dearness allowance (DA) and dearness relief (DR) by 4 per cent with retrospective effect from January 1, 2023.
The decision was taken in the Union Cabinet meeting on Friday evening.
According to official sources, the additional instalment will represent an increase of 4 per cent over the existing rate of 38 per cent of the basic pay or pension, to compensate against price rise.
The cabinet gave its approval to release an additional instalment of DA to Central government employees and DRA to pensioners with effect from January 1, 2023, they added.
The combined impact on the exchequer on account of both DA and DR would be Rs 12,815.60 crore per annum, the sources added.
This increase is in accordance with the accepted formula, which is based on the recommendations of the 7th Central Pay Commission.
DA is calculated as per the latest consumer price index for industrial workers. It is revised periodically twice a year and was last revised in September 2022, and was effective retrospectively from July 1, 2022.

Google searches for ‘The Elephant Whisperers’ skyrocketed 8,164% after Oscar win

Online searches for “The Elephant Whisperers” on Google skyrocketed by a whopping 8,164 per cent worldwide after winning the award for the Best Documentary Short Film at the 95th Academy Awards, a report showed on Friday.
The finding by African media company Celeb Tattler revealed that the online searches for “Mudumalai National Park” soared by 246 per cent worldwide after the Oscar win of ‘The Elephant Whisperers’.
“After making history at this year’s Academy Awards, The Elephant Whisperers is receiving a huge boost in online searches. Not only being embraced by Hollywood – but also the world,” said a spokesperson for Celeb Tattler.
“The movie, released last year, and scored an unheard-of 100 per cent on Rotten Tomatoes, was praised for its compelling narrative. Now, after winning the ‘Documentary Short Film’ award at this year’s Oscars ceremony, the movie’s profile is being boosted far beyond its initial release,” it added.
Moreover, Guneet Monga, the producer of the film, also received a profile boost from the award-winning documentary, receiving almost 30,000 new followers since the award ceremony, said the report.
Kartiki Gonsalves also got deserved attention for her directorial role, as her Wikipedia page views exploded after the Oscars ceremony by over 1,25,000.
In addition, her Instagram account gained over 25,000 followers, almost doubling her follower count overnight, the report mentioned.
Meanwhile, online searches for “Naatu Naatu” on Google skyrocketed by a whopping 1,105 per cent worldwide after the super-hit song from the Telugu blockbuster “RRR” won the Best Original Song at the 95th Academy Awards, according to a report.

How to avoid falling victim to deep fake technology

The rise of deep fake technology has become a growing concern for online security experts and individuals alike.
The ability to create fake videos and images that are the same as the real thing has created a new wave of potential dangers for users of social media and other online platforms.
Here’s the concept of deep fake technology and the potential risks it poses to online security:
What is deep fake technology?
Deep fake technology is a technique that uses artificial intelligence (AI) to manipulate videos or images in a way that makes them appear to be real, even though they are entirely fabricated.
This technology has become more advanced over the years, and it is now possible to create deep fakes that are almost impossible to make out from the real thing.
This has led to a range of potential dangers, including the spread of fake news, the manipulation of public opinion, and the creation of false identities online.

How to avoid falling victim to deep fake technology:
Before sharing or reacting to any news, video or image, always verify the source of the content. If the source is not reliable or the content seems suspicious, it is better to avoid it.
Deep fakes often have inconsistencies, such as strange movements or distorted features. Keep an eye out for anything that seems out of place or doesn’t match up with reality.
The more personal information you share online, the easier it is for someone to create a deep fake of you. Be careful about what you share on social media, and avoid sharing sensitive information.
Make use of privacy settings on social media platforms to limit who can see your content. This can help prevent your photos and videos from being used for deep fakes.
Stay up to date on the latest news and trends in deep fake technology. The more you know about this issue, the better prepared you will be to protect yourself and others.
